The chapter explores three-dimensional geometry, extending the concepts of coordinate geometry into space. It details the coordinate axes, the coordinates of points in three-dimensional space, and important formulas for calculating distances and intersections within this space. This foundational knowledge is crucial for analyzing spatial relationships and understanding geometric figures that exist beyond the two-dimensional plane.

Term: ThreeDimensional Geometry
Definition: A field of study that analyzes figures and spatial relationships in three dimensions using coordinates.
Term: Coordinates
Definition: A triplet of values (x, y, z) that define a point's position in three-dimensional space.
Term: Distance Formula
Definition: The formula used to calculate the distance between two points in space, derived from an extension of the Pythagorean theorem.
Term: Section Formula
Definition: A formula that determines the coordinates of a point that divides a line segment between two points in a given ratio in three-dimensional space.
